Retail Apprenticeships

Below is an overview of the Retail Apprenticeship, outlining the qualifications you will achieve and the units and vocational areas you will cover throughout your training as well as other important information such as course duration and funding.

Apprenticeship

Qualifications
  • Apprenticeship in Retail Skills
  • Level 2 Diploma in Retail Skills
  • Technical Certificate in Retail Knowledge Level 2
  • Key Skill Application of Number Level 1
  • Key Skill Communication Level 1
Units covered Depending on your job role you could cover a range of the following topics through your Diploma for example:

  • Work effectively in a Retail team
  • Organising the receipt and storage of stock
  • Displaying and merchandising stock
  • Promoting loyalty schemes to customers
  • Processing payments

Duration 12 months (approx)
Start date Available all year
Assessment method You will put together a portfolio of evidence that will be assessed using a range of methods. Observation of real work will be used for all competence based units, in addition you will be asked to provide witness testimony and discussion and carry out knowledge based questions. You will be required to complete some online tests.
Personal qualities To work in a retail environment you will need to have the following personal qualities:

  • Team worker
  • Good people skills
  • Punctual and reliable
  • Able to follow instructions
Further progression Once you have completed your Apprenticeship you can look at moving on to level 3 Diploma in Retail Skills, dependent on your job role.

Advanced Apprenticeship

Qualifications
  • Advanced Apprenticeship in Retail Skills
  • Level 3 Diploma in Retail Skills – either Sales Professional, Visual Merchandising or Management (dependant on job role)
  • Technical Certificate in Retail Knowledge Level 3
  • Key Skill Application of Number Level 2
  • Key Skill Communication Level 2
Units covered Depending on your job role you could cover a range of the following topics through your Diploma for example:

  • Help to manage a retail team
  • Organise the delivery of reliable customer service
  • Order graphic materials for visual merchandising displays
  • Source required goods and services in a retail environment
